The conventional audio device includes an AC-3 audio decoder 10 for receiving an audio bitstream. The down mixer 20 and the digital output format unit 40 are connected to the rear end of the AC-3 audio decoder 10. The AC-3 audio decoder 10 decodes the audio bitstream signal and outputs a 5.1 channel signal. Here, the 5.1-channel audio signal includes a center channel C and two surround channels Ls and Rs in the left and right channels L and R. In addition, near the center channel (C) further includes a low frequency enhancement channel (Lfe) capable of processing audio signals in the range from 15 kHz to 120 kHz. The downmixer 20 synthesizes 5.1 channels (L, R, C, Ls, Rs, Lfe) input from the AC-3 audio decoder 10 by 2 channels (L + R, C + Lfe, Ls + Rs). To the digital-to-analog converter (DAC) 30. The DAC 30 converts the PCM audio signal (digital signal) converted into two channels into an analog signal and outputs it. That is, they are output as analog 5.1 channel (L, R, C, Lfe, Ls, Rs) signals, respectively. In addition, the AC-3 audio decoder 10 extracts necessary data from the audio bitstream signal and outputs the AC-3 bitstream signal compressed to the AC-3 standard to the digital output formatter 40. The digital output formatter 40 converts the compressed AC-3 bit stream signal into an outputable format.
그러나, 위와같은 현재의 AC-3오디오시스템에서는 압축된 AC-3비트스트림신호는 외부 디지털기기로는 녹음이 불가능하다. 즉, 일반적으로 디지털신호를 녹음하는 방식인 펄스부호변조(PCM; Pulse Code Modulation)방식을 갖는 오디오 레코더 예를들어, 디지털테이프(DAT; Digital Audio Tape)레코더 또는 MD(Mini Disk)레코더등으로는 녹음이 불가능하였다.However, in the current AC-3 audio system as described above, a compressed AC-3 bit stream signal cannot be recorded by an external digital device. That is, an audio recorder having a pulse code modulation (PCM) method, which generally records digital signals, for example, a digital audio tape (DAT) recorder or an MD (Mini Disk) recorder, etc. Recording was not possible.

Output The down mixer 20 receives 5.1 channels and outputs digital signals synthesized by two channels. That is, the downmixer 20 receives 5.1 channels (L, R, C, Ls, Rs, Lfe) and downmixes the two channel signals (L + R, C + Lfe, Ls + Rs) to the DAC 30. Will output Further, the entire digital audio signal Lt + Rt, which is a combination of all 5.1 channel signals L, R, C, Ls, Rs, and Lfe, is output. The selector 50 is connected to the down mixer 20 and the output terminal of the AC-3 audio decoder 10. The selector 50 controls the compressed AC-3 bitstream signal from the AC-3 audio coder 10 and the entire digital audio signal Lt + Rt from the downmixer 20 according to the control signal from the control unit 60. Select one of the The selected signal is applied to the digital output format unit 40. When the digital output format unit 40 receives the compressed AC-3 bit stream signal from the selector 50, the digital output format unit 40 converts the output signal into an output format corresponding to the AC-3 audio signal. In addition, when the digital output format unit 40 receives the entire digital audio signal Lt + Rt obtained by synthesizing all 5.1 channels from the selector 50, the digital output format unit 40 converts the output signal into a corresponding output format. In the embodiment, the digital output format unit 40 mainly uses IC958. The digital output format unit 40 may be connected to an external digital device, that is, an audio recorder having a pulse code modulation (PCM) method, that is, a digital audio tape (DAT) recorder or an MD (Mini Disk) recorder. In addition, it is possible to record by receiving the entire digital audio signal (Lt + Rt) synthesized with all 5.1 channels.
